Norman Rockwell
An American painter and illustrator known for his depictions of American culture, producing covers for The Saturday Evening Post magazine for nearly five decades.
Economic Conservatism
A political and economic ideology that advocates for free market policies, limited government intervention, and fiscal restraint to encourage economic growth.
World War II
A global military conflict that lasted from 1939 to 1945, involving most of the world's nations including all of the great powers, eventually forming two opposing military alliances: the Allies and the Axis.
